    What is Food Delivery?

    Food Delivery

    Introduction to Food Delivery

    Food delivery, in the context of industrial and commercial real estate, has evolved from a niche service to a critical component of modern supply chains and tenant experience. Initially a convenience for consumers, it now encompasses a complex network of fulfillment centers, last-mile logistics operations, and specialized infrastructure supporting the movement of prepared food from restaurants and kitchens to end-users. This isn't solely about individual orders delivered to homes; it increasingly involves bulk deliveries to office buildings, corporate campuses, and even within industrial parks, driven by changing workforce dynamics and a demand for on-site amenities. The rise of ghost kitchens, dark kitchens, and virtual restaurants further complicates the landscape, requiring specialized warehouse and distribution solutions unlike traditional retail or e-commerce fulfillment.

    The impact on industrial and commercial real estate is significant, demanding new design considerations, zoning approvals, and infrastructure investments. We're seeing a surge in demand for smaller, strategically located “micro-fulfillment” facilities near urban centers and within industrial estates, capable of handling high volumes of prepared meals. The pandemic accelerated this trend, but the underlying factors – the desire for convenience, the changing nature of work, and the growth of online ordering – suggest a sustained and evolving need. Furthermore, food delivery operations necessitate robust refrigeration, specialized loading docks, and efficient routing systems, adding layers of complexity to existing property management and logistics strategies. Understanding this dynamic is crucial for investors, developers, and property managers seeking to capitalize on the burgeoning food delivery market.

    Subheader: Principles of Food Delivery

    The core principles of food delivery within a commercial or industrial context revolve around speed, temperature control, and traceability. Efficient route optimization, leveraging real-time data and predictive analytics, is paramount to minimizing delivery times and maximizing throughput. Maintaining the integrity of the food – preserving its temperature and freshness – is non-negotiable, requiring specialized packaging, refrigerated vehicles, and strict adherence to food safety protocols. Traceability, from ingredient sourcing to final delivery, is increasingly important for regulatory compliance and consumer trust, necessitating robust tracking systems and data management. These principles dictate the design of fulfillment centers, the selection of transportation methods, and the training of delivery personnel, impacting everything from building layout to operational workflows. Strategic planning must incorporate these principles to ensure profitability and compliance while adapting to the rapidly changing demands of the market.

    Subheader: Key Concepts in Food Delivery

    Several key concepts are central to understanding food delivery operations. "Dark kitchens," also known as ghost kitchens, are commercial cooking facilities solely dedicated to fulfilling online orders, lacking a traditional storefront. "Micro-fulfillment centers" are smaller, strategically located facilities designed to handle high volumes of prepared food within a localized area. "Last-mile logistics" specifically refers to the final leg of the delivery process, from the fulfillment center to the customer's location, often the most expensive and challenging part. "Food miles" represent the distance food travels from origin to consumption, a growing concern for sustainability and efficiency. "Cold chain integrity" describes the unbroken series of refrigerated steps required to maintain food safety and quality throughout the entire delivery process. For example, a restaurant utilizing a dark kitchen might contract with a third-party logistics provider specializing in last-mile delivery, ensuring the cold chain is maintained from the kitchen to the office building reception desk.

    Applications of Food Delivery

    Food delivery is impacting industrial and commercial real estate in diverse ways, ranging from supporting ghost kitchen operations to enhancing tenant amenities. In some industrial parks, we’re seeing the emergence of dedicated food delivery hubs, offering a curated selection of local restaurants and catering services directly to employees within the park. Commercial buildings are increasingly incorporating on-demand food delivery services as a tenant amenity, attracting and retaining high-value tenants. Conversely, traditional retail spaces are repurposing into ghost kitchens, demonstrating a shift in the retail landscape driven by changing consumer behavior. The contrast is stark: a large distribution center might house a dedicated food prep area for employee meals, while a Class A office tower might partner with a third-party delivery service to provide a wide range of culinary options.

    The rise of coworking spaces has further amplified the demand for food delivery solutions. These flexible workspaces often lack traditional cafeteria facilities, relying heavily on on-demand food delivery to cater to the needs of their members. This creates a significant opportunity for food delivery providers and industrial properties that can accommodate the specialized requirements of ghost kitchens and micro-fulfillment centers. For instance, a coworking operator might negotiate a partnership with a local restaurant to provide exclusive discounts and priority delivery to its members, creating a value-added service and strengthening tenant loyalty. The ability to seamlessly integrate food delivery into the tenant experience is becoming a key differentiator in the competitive commercial real estate market.

    Subheader: Industrial Applications

    Industrial facilities are experiencing a significant transformation due to the rise of food delivery. Beyond traditional warehousing, we’re seeing the emergence of dedicated “food hubs” within industrial parks, offering a centralized location for ghost kitchens and micro-fulfillment centers. These hubs often include specialized infrastructure, such as refrigerated loading docks, high-speed internet connectivity, and dedicated parking for delivery vehicles. Operational metrics like “order fulfillment time” and “delivery accuracy” are critical for these facilities, driving investments in automation and process optimization. Technology stacks often include warehouse management systems (WMS) integrated with route optimization software and real-time tracking systems. For example, a 500,000 sq ft industrial facility might dedicate 50,000 sq ft to a cluster of ghost kitchens, generating additional revenue and attracting a diverse tenant base.

    Subheader: Commercial Applications

    Commercial real estate, particularly office buildings and coworking spaces, is actively incorporating food delivery as a key tenant amenity. Building management teams are partnering with third-party delivery platforms to offer seamless ordering experiences for tenants, often integrating ordering directly into building apps or digital directories. Retail spaces that were previously occupied by restaurants are being converted into dark kitchens, demonstrating the adaptability of commercial real estate in response to changing consumer habits. The tenant experience is paramount; a smooth, efficient food delivery process can significantly enhance employee satisfaction and productivity. Coworking spaces, lacking traditional dining options, are particularly reliant on food delivery services to cater to their members' needs, creating a significant opportunity for specialized logistics providers.

    Challenges and Opportunities in Food Delivery

    The food delivery sector is currently navigating a complex landscape, balancing rapid growth with significant operational and economic challenges. While the pandemic initially fueled explosive growth, rising fuel costs, labor shortages, and increased competition are impacting profitability. The industry is also facing regulatory scrutiny regarding worker classification and environmental sustainability. However, these challenges also present opportunities for innovation and strategic investment, particularly for properties and logistics providers that can adapt to the evolving market dynamics. The future success of food delivery hinges on addressing these challenges while capitalizing on the underlying demand for convenience and on-site amenities.

    Subheader: Current Challenges

    One of the most pressing challenges is the ongoing labor shortage, particularly among delivery drivers, leading to increased wages and operational inefficiencies. Rising fuel costs are significantly impacting delivery expenses, squeezing profit margins for both restaurants and logistics providers. Regulatory uncertainty surrounding worker classification – whether delivery drivers should be classified as employees or independent contractors – is creating legal and financial risks. Food safety concerns, particularly regarding temperature control and hygiene, require constant vigilance and adherence to strict protocols. The "dark kitchen" phenomenon, while offering opportunities, also raises concerns about zoning regulations and potential negative impacts on surrounding communities. For instance, a delivery service might be experiencing a 20% driver attrition rate due to low wages and demanding work conditions.

    Subheader: Market Opportunities

    The increasing demand for on-site amenities and convenient food options presents a significant opportunity for industrial and commercial properties. Investing in specialized infrastructure, such as refrigerated loading docks and dedicated food prep areas, can attract high-value tenants and generate additional revenue streams. The rise of sustainable food delivery practices, such as electric vehicle fleets and eco-friendly packaging, caters to environmentally conscious consumers and enhances brand reputation. The integration of artificial intelligence and machine learning can optimize route planning, predict demand, and personalize the delivery experience. For example, a developer might construct a new industrial park specifically designed to accommodate a cluster of ghost kitchens, attracting a diverse tenant base and creating a thriving food hub.

    Future Directions in Food Delivery

    The food delivery sector is poised for continued evolution, driven by technological advancements and changing consumer preferences. We can expect to see increased automation in fulfillment centers, the proliferation of drone delivery services, and a greater emphasis on personalized and sustainable delivery options. The lines between traditional restaurants, ghost kitchens, and grocery stores will continue to blur, creating new opportunities for innovation and disruption. Understanding these future trends is crucial for investors, developers, and property managers seeking to capitalize on the evolving food delivery landscape.

    Subheader: Emerging Trends

    One of the most significant emerging trends is the adoption of drone delivery services, particularly in densely populated urban areas and remote locations. Autonomous delivery robots are also gaining traction, offering a cost-effective and environmentally friendly alternative to traditional delivery vehicles. Personalized food delivery experiences, driven by data analytics and artificial intelligence, will become increasingly common, allowing consumers to customize their orders and delivery preferences. The rise of “virtual restaurants” – restaurants that exist only online and operate solely through delivery platforms – is expected to continue, further disrupting the traditional restaurant model. Vendor categories like drone manufacturers, robotics developers, and AI-powered logistics platforms will see significant growth.

    Subheader: Technology Integration

    The integration of blockchain technology will enhance traceability and transparency throughout the food delivery supply chain, ensuring food safety and building consumer trust. The use of predictive analytics will optimize route planning, predict demand, and personalize the delivery experience. The implementation of Internet of Things (IoT) sensors will monitor temperature control and track food quality in real-time. Integration patterns will focus on seamless data exchange between restaurant POS systems, warehouse management systems, and delivery tracking platforms. Change management considerations will be crucial to ensure smooth adoption and minimize disruption to existing workflows. A recommended technology stack might include a WMS integrated with a route optimization platform and a blockchain-based traceability system.
